  • Type casting problem

    Hi all

    I have a problem of Type casting. Could yu if you please help me solve.
    I am trying to initialize the variable v with sysdate (' Mon - dd - yy:hh:mi:ss'), but was unable to initialize. I've been able to do in the body, but is it not possible to do so in the context of the statement?
    I could do it like this
    DECLARE 
      v varchar2(25);
    BEGIN
      SELECT to_char(sysdate,'mon-dd-yy:hh:mi:ss') INTO v FROM dual;
      DBMS_OUTPUT.PUT_LINE(v);
    END;
    
    Output looks like this: jan-19-12:04:32:11
    But how to do it as part of the declaration?
    DECLARE 
      v varchar2(25);
      v := to_date(sysdate, 'mon-dd-...') ? ? ?
    BEGIN
        DBMS_OUTPUT.PUT_LINE(v);
    END;
    THX
    Rod.

    Hello

    I think you want something like this:

    DECLARE
      v varchar2(25):= to_char(sysdate, 'mon-dd-yyyy');
    
    BEGIN
        DBMS_OUTPUT.PUT_LINE(v);
    END;

  • java.lang.ClassCastException:String cannot be cast to java.sql.Date

    I have a date component. MinValue named Id2 and the following code is to run a class cast exception indicating that the string value cannot be cast to a date sql

    java.sql.Date dateNeeded = (java.sql.Date) this.getId2 () .getValue ();

    can someone help me to overcome this problem.

    Thanks and greetings
    Janak

    Published by: new_to_ORACLE on February 18, 2011 16:56

    Published by: new_to_ORACLE on February 18, 2011 16:58

    the Date attribute is of type object oracle.jbo.domain.Date
    so, first try to cast to oracle.jbo.domain.Date. then to java.sql.Date object

    If you need to cast to another Date object, see this site:
    http://www.ecotronics.ch/webdesign/javadate.htm
